> BTW, the smoky toasty smell in my 1985 300TD only appears rarely now,
> and then for only about 30 seconds before vanishing as mysteriously as
> it came.  This has been achieved after severa engine degreasing
> efforts; there must still be a remnant patch of SLS fluid somewhere
> that I haven't reached (it leaked out 4 liters in 2 months before I
> found the pinhole in the line). I am now ready to have the car
> repainted so it's less of an embarrassment to be seen driving it.
